                      3: /*
                      4:  * Definitions of the TCP timers.  These timers are counted
                      5:  * down PR_SLOWHZ times a second.
                      6:  */
                      7: #define        TCPT_NTIMERS    4
                      8: 
                      9: #define        TCPT_REXMT      0               /* retransmit */
                     10: #define        TCPT_PERSIST    1               /* retransmit persistance */
                     11: #define        TCPT_KEEP       2               /* keep alive */
                     12: #define        TCPT_2MSL       3               /* 2*msl quiet time timer */
                     13: 
                     14: /*
                     15:  * The TCPT_REXMT timer is used to force retransmissions.
                     16:  * The TCP has the TCPT_REXMT timer set whenever segments
                     17:  * have been sent for which ACKs are expected but not yet
                     18:  * received.  If an ACK is received which advances tp->snd_una,
                     19:  * then the retransmit timer is cleared (if there are no more
                     20:  * outstanding segments) or reset to the base value (if there
                     21:  * are more ACKs expected).  Whenever the retransmit timer goes off,
                     22:  * we retransmit all unacknowledged segments, and do an exponential
                     23:  * backoff on the retransmit timer.
                     24:  *
                     25:  * The TCPT_PERSIST timer is used to keep window size information
                     26:  * flowing even if the window goes shut.  If all previous transmissions
                     27:  * have been acknowledged (so that there are no retransmissions in progress),
                     28:  * and the window is shut, then we start the TCPT_PERSIST timer, and at
                     29:  * intervals send a single byte into the peers window to force him to update
                     30:  * our window information.  We do this at most as often as TCPT_PERSMIN
                     31:  * time intervals, but no more frequently than the current estimate of
                     32:  * round-trip packet time.  The TCPT_PERSIST timer is cleared whenever
                     33:  * we receive a window update from the peer.
                     34:  *
                     35:  * The TCPT_KEEP timer is used to keep connections alive.  If an
                     36:  * connection is idle (no segments received) for TCPTV_KEEP amount of time,
                     37:  * but not yet established, then we drop the connection.  If the connection
                     38:  * is established, then we force the peer to send us a segment by sending:
                     39:  *     <SEQ=SND.UNA-1><ACK=RCV.NXT><CTL=ACK>
                     40:  * This segment is (deliberately) outside the window, and should elicit
                     41:  * an ack segment in response from the peer.  If, despite the TCPT_KEEP
                     42:  * initiated segments we cannot elicit a response from a peer in TCPT_MAXIDLE
                     43:  * amount of time, then we drop the connection.
                     44:  */

                     71: /*
                     72:  * Retransmission smoothing constants.
                     73:  * Smoothed round trip time is updated by
                     74:  *    tp->t_srtt = (tcp_alpha * tp->t_srtt) + ((1 - tcp_alpha) * tp->t_rtt)
                     75:  * each time a new value of tp->t_rtt is available.  The initial
                     76:  * retransmit timeout is then based on
                     77:  *    tp->t_timer[TCPT_REXMT] = tcp_beta * tp->t_srtt;
                     78:  * limited, however to be at least TCPTV_REXMTLO and at most TCPTV_REXMTHI.
                     79:  */
                     80: float  tcp_alpha, tcp_beta;
                     81: 
                     82: /*
                     83:  * Initial values of tcp_alpha and tcp_beta.
                     84:  * These are conservative: averaging over a long
                     85:  * period of time, and allowing for large individual deviations from
                     86:  * tp->t_srtt.
                     87:  */
                     88: #define        TCP_ALPHA       0.9
                     89: #define        TCP_BETA        2.0
